2920. κρίσις κρί^σις, εως [κρίνω] I. a separating, power of distinguishing, Arist.: choice, selection, id=Arist.
II. a decision, judgment, Hdt., Aesch.; κρ. οὐκ ἀληθής no certain means of judging, Soph.
2. in legal sense, a trial, Ar., Thuc., etc.:— the result of a trial, condemnation, Xen.
3. a trial of skill, τόξου in archery, Soph.
4. a dispute, περί τινος Hdt.
III. the event or issue of a thing, κρίσιν ἔχειν to be decided, of a war, Thuc.

2920. κρίσις krivsis krisis {kree'-sis}
decision (subjectively or objectively, for or against); by extension, a tribunal; by implication, justice (especially, divine law):--accusation, condemnation, damnation, judgment.
